Two things come to mind - either permissions or a stale lock file. 

Do a drive filename search on ".lck" and see what comes up. 

Permissions have been known to be a pain as well. If you open up to 666 and no joy, then there is a lock file floating out there.

"Curt, WE7U" <archer at eskimo.com> wrote: On Wed, 25 Jul 2007, Earl Needham wrote:

> >You might have another sound daemon that already has control of
> >/dev/dsp.  That'd be my first guess.
>
>          How would I go about finding it?

First thought would be to do a "ps auxww | sort | less" and see what
processes you have running.  Look for names with "snd" or "sound" or
"audio" in them.  Or perhaps "dsp".  Anyone have more suggestions
for him?
